Understanding Acrylic Tubs
Acrylic tubs are made from a malleable plastic material that’s strengthened with fiberglass to increase structural strength. This creates a portable yet robust bathtub that holds heat well and is comfortable to use.
Unlike porcelain-coated or metal tubs, acrylic options are more manageable and come in a wide variety of configurations, including compact soaking tubs and freestanding centerpieces.
Why Choose an Acrylic Tub
1. Easy to Handle and Quick to Set Up
Acrylic tubs are much lighter than traditional options, making them ideal for upper-floor bathrooms.
2. Heat Retention
Thanks to their thermal properties, acrylic tubs help hold water temperature for longer baths—reducing the need to reheat warm water.
3. Stylish and Cost-Effective
If you’re budget-conscious but still want a designer feel, acrylic tubs are a great solution. They replicate the look of more expensive materials and allow for easy design flexibility.
4. Tough and Low Maintenance
With the right care, acrylic tubs are scratch-resistant, hold their finish, and won’t fade over time. Cleaning is simple—just use a soft cloth and gentle cleaner.
